Redis TTL 命令
-
描述
TTL 命令用于获取键到期的剩余时间(以秒为单位)。 -
句法
以下是此命令的简单语法-redis 127.0.0.1:6379> TTL KEY_NAME
-
返回值
整数值TTL(以毫秒为单位)或负值。- TTL(以毫秒为单位)。
- -1,如果键没有到期超时。
- -2,如果键不存在。
-
示例
首先,在Redis中创建一个键,并在其中设置一些值。redis 127.0.0.1:6379> SET tutorialname redis OK
现在,设置键的到期时间,然后检查剩余的到期时间。redis 127.0.0.1:6379> EXPIRE tutorialname 60 1) (integer) 1 redis 127.0.0.1:6379> TTL tutorialname 1) (integer) 59